1 <VARIABLE AUDIO OUT> terminal
This is the terminal to output audio signal input to the
projector.
2 <VIDEO IN> terminal
This is the terminal to input video signals.
3 <COMPUTER 1 IN> terminal

4 <COMPUTER 2 IN/ 1 OUT> terminal
This is the terminal to input RGB signals or output the
RGB
signals to external monitor.
5 <HDMI IN> terminal
This is the terminal to input HDMI signals.
6 <LAN> terminal
This is the LAN terminal to connect to the network.
7 <USB B (DISPLAY)> terminal
This terminal is used to connect the projector to the
computer with a USB cable when you want to use the
USB Display function.
8 <USB A (VIEWER)> terminal
When using the Memory Viewer function, insert the USB
memory directly to this terminal.
9 <AUDIO IN 1> terminal
This is the terminal to input computer audio signals.
In addition, if you have set [HDMI setup] → [Sound]
to [Computer], it outputs the analog audio of the input
signal which is input to <AUDIO IN 1> terminal when the
HDMI input source is selected.

There are a left (L) terminal and a right (R) terminal.
11 <SERIAL IN> terminal
This is the RS-232C compatible terminal to externally
control the projector by connecting a computer.
